Do you know the spelling of the name when they immigrated? In searching for the Dobroc's I found them with a strange spelling in the Dell in the 1920 census. Do you know of other spellings. I keep finding then losing these folks. Here is the 1920 Census: 1920 MI, Grand Traverse County, Traverse City, Prec. 2, Sheet 2B, ED 28; M625-767, pg. 163b, Line 88, Dw# 46, Fm# 46; 513 Second St. 3 Jan 1920 DELL, Jospeh, head, owns home free, 41, m, im: 1878, NA in 1902, b. Russia/Poland Polish; fb. Russia/Poland mb. Russia Poland; occ: Labor in Auto factory Mary wife, 38, married, im: 1885, NA in 1902, b. Russia Poland; fb. Russia Poland; mb. Russia Poland; occ: Cigar Maker in Cigar Factory Julian, son, 16, single, b. MI Louise V., dau, 14, MI Irene G., dau, 11, MI Arthur J, son, 7, MI Zielinski, Catherine, MIL, 75, widow, im in 1885, AL, b. Russia Poland POlish; mb. Russia Poland; fb. Russia Poland I would be happy to share was little information I have on this family. I have been attempting to find out where in Poland this Zielinki family came from and resided. According to the departing Hamburg records [1885] it looks like Swietkowa. John Stanley Zielinski's Social Security Application says he was born in Warsaw [1879]. Mary Dobroc also had a Social Security Application which I have applied to get a copy. My mother-in-law always said her understanding was the family was from Krakow. As far as I know all my be true.
